Job Description

This is a remote position.

Our client is a science and compliance consulting firm globally serving consumer health product companies in Natural Health Products, Dietary Supplements, Over-The-Counter DIN products, Foods and Cosmetics regulatory and quality areas.

Our client is seeking an experienced and dynamic Regulatory Affairs Specialist to join their team. This role will focus on regulatory submissions and quality assurance activities, with a particular emphasis on Natural Health Products (NHPs), supplemented foods, cosmetic products, Site License (SL) amendments, and QA product release under their Quality Importation Services (QIS) division.

Roles and Responsibilities:

  • Prepare and submit regulatory applications in compliance with Health Canada requirements, ensuring timely and accurate filings across product categories.
  • Manage SL amendment applications and updates, ensuring facilities remain compliant with evolving regulatory requirements.
  • Conduct quality assurance reviews and product release activities for Quality Importation Services, ensuring imported products meet regulatory and quality standards.
  • Act as a strategic advisor to clients, providing expert regulatory and quality guidance with a focus on efficient, practical solutions.
  • Communicate with regulatory authorities to address inquiries, resolve issues, and facilitate licensing and product approvals.
  • Manage multiple client projects and deadlines simultaneously, maintaining high accuracy and responsiveness in a fast-paced environment.
  • Work closely with internal and external stakeholders to align regulatory and quality priorities with broader business goals.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Life Sciences, Regulatory Affairs, Quality Assurance, or a related field.
  • Minimum 3 years of regulatory and/or quality assurance experience, ideally within a consulting or fast-paced, multi-client environment.
  • Strong understanding of Canadian regulations for natural health products, supplemented foods, cosmetics, and site licensing.
  • Proven experience preparing and submitting regulatory filings to Health Canada, including SL amendments and product licensing.
  • Familiarity with quality assurance processes related to product release, especially within importation frameworks like QIS.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to explain complex regulatory concepts clearly to clients.
  • Demonstrated ability to manage multiple deadlines and prioritize tasks effectively in high-pressure situations.
  • Client-focused with strong problem-solving skills and a solutions-oriented approach to regulatory challenges.
  • Comfortable working collaboratively with internal teams and contributing to a supportive team environment.
